After flying high against Harford Christian on Saturday, Frederick Christian Academy came back down to earth. The Defenders lost 63-41 to the King's Christian Academy Eagles on Tuesday. The Defenders were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Eagles apparently hadn't forgotten their loss the last time these teams played back in February of 2019.
Elijah Burgess had another great game (as he tends to do), shooting 60% from the field on his way to 15 points and six boards for King's Christian Academy. Those 60% field goal percentage gave Burgess a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Rodney Hunt, who posted seven points and five assists.
Frederick Christian Academy's defeat dropped their record down to 20-7. As for King's Christian Academy, their record is now 12-18.
Frederick Christian Academy does not have any more games scheduled as of now. As for King's Christian Academy, they will square off against Southern Maryland Christian Academy at 6:00 p.m. on Friday. The Eagles will need to watch out since the Mustangs have now posted at least 55 points every time they've taken the court this season.
